All the flavor of a delicous cheeseburger, minus the bun. This is the perfect meal for a night when you feel like enjoying a burger, but don't want to grill outside.
Place flour and salt in a small bowl. Cut in ½ cup shortening using a pastry blender, fork or your fingers to combine until the mixture looks like tiny peas. Sprinkle with 3-4 tablespoons cold water, adding water 1 tablespoon at a time. Mix lightly until all of the flour is combined and the pastry cleans the sides of the bowl.
Pat the pastry dough in the bottom and up the sides of a quiche dish, 10" pie plate or 9" x 9" baking dish. Bake for 15 minutes, remove from the oven.
Cook the Filling
While the crust bakes, place olive oil in a skillet and heat until the oil shimmers. Add the ground beef and cook until the meat is no longer pink. Remove and drain beef. In the same skillet, cook onion and garlic until the onion is softened. Return the beef to the pan with the cooked onions and garlic and sprinkle with salt and flour. Stir in pickle juice, milk, chopped pickles and 1 cup of shredded cheese, stir and cook over low/medium heat until the cheese is melted and the ingredients are combined. Spoon the meat and cheese mixture into the baked crust.
Bake
Place the pie pan containing all of the ingredients in the oven and bake for another 15 minutes, then sprinkle with the remaining 1 cup of cheese and bake five minutes longer.Remove from oven. As an option, garnish with sliced tomatoes, onion and pickle with a sprinkle of sesame seeds as garnish. Serve and enjoy!
Notes
I've made this using just 1 pound of ground beef, so if that's what's in your fridge it'll work fine with this recipe. Serve with plenty of sliced tomatoes, pickles, ketchup and mustard. Delicious!
